Endangered fire-dependent flowers are emerging in South Africa's Western Cape Overberg region following recent intense wildfires. Botanists and citizen scientists are documenting these rare blooms amid the scorched landscapes. The discoveries include highly endangered species unique to the area.

Table Mountain's fynbos vegetation represents a complex ecosystem developed over 60 million years, spared from glacial resets and refined by fire and time. Botanist Dr Jasper Slingsby highlights its hidden diversity and resilience. Modern tools like satellites aid in understanding this ancient flora.
